Ottawa Senators at New York Islanders: why the road margin may be the real question
Current radar readings paint a familiar picture: Ottawa carries the higher talent ceiling, a sharper finishing edge, and steadier netminding conditions. That's straightforward enough. The trickier front is whether that advantage justifies a road puck line in a matchup primed for compression.
Here's where the barometer starts dipping. The Senators could dominate stretches, particularly if their top guns spark transition storms. But the Islanders at home tend to brew slower, tighter games than the markets might forecast. Post-coaching reset, New York's leaned into structure over chaos—a shift that could crimp Ottawa's flow when possessions tighten up.
The total near 6 matters more than the favorite tag
With a total hovering around 6, the forecast already hints at constrained scoring windows. That bumps up the cost of every extra goal needed for separation. Pricing a road favorite for a multi-goal cushion in those conditions? That's a high-pressure system, especially in a league where one-goal games linger late and empty-net turbulence stirs the pot.
That's the brewing tension. Ottawa still scans stronger on paper, with Ullmark anchoring the crease, while the Islanders miss some wing depth if Holmstrom's sidelined. Yet Sorokin brings that unpredictable gust—enough to level talent gaps and keep margins dicey. Toss in New York's forecheck and ice-tightening habits, and this shapes up less like a blowout front and more like a prolonged squeeze.
Why market watchers should eye the cushion, not just the front-runner
This breakdown doesn't demand New York as the superior squad to challenge the markets. It just needs narrow scoring lanes, and this clash offers multiple paths there. Ottawa's attack holds real bite, but the pricing might overweight team quality while underplaying game script.
The total feels fairly calibrated, the outright narrative clear-cut, and the real intrigue swirls around the favorite's demanded margin. That's the angle worth tracking before the numbers shift.
